- Summary:
- Structures and Architecture - REstructure REmaterialize REthink REuse contains the contributions to the 6th International Conference on Structures and Architecture (ICSA 2025, Antwerp, Belgium, 8-11 July 2025). The papers call for a re-imagination of current practices regarding structures and architecture.
